/**
|
||||
* @brief The SingleApplication class handles multipe instances of the same
|
||||
* Application
|
||||
* @see QCoreApplication
|
||||
*/
|
||||
class SingleApplication : public QAPPLICATION_CLASS {
|
||||
Q_OBJECT
|
||||
|
||||
typedef QAPPLICATION_CLASS app_t;
|
||||
|
||||
public:
|
||||
/**
|
||||
* @brief Mode of operation of SingleApplication.
|
||||
* Whether the block should be user-wide or system-wide and whether the
|
||||
* primary instance should be notified when a secondary instance had been
|
||||
* started.
|
||||
* @note Operating system can restrict the shared memory blocks to the same
|
||||
* user, in which case the User/System modes will have no effect and the
|
||||
* block will be user wide.
|
||||
* @enum
|
||||
*/
|
||||
enum Mode {
|
||||
User = 1 << 0,
|
||||
System = 1 << 1,
|
||||
SecondaryNotification = 1 << 2,
|
||||
ExcludeAppVersion = 1 << 3,
|
||||
ExcludeAppPath = 1 << 4
|
||||
};
|
||||
|
||||
Q_DECLARE_FLAGS(Options, Mode)
|
||||
|
||||
/**
|
||||
* @brief Intitializes a SingleApplication instance with argc command line
|
||||
* arguments in argv
|
||||
* @arg {int &} argc - Number of arguments in argv
|
||||
* @arg {const char *[]} argv - Supplied command line arguments
|
||||
* @arg {bool} allowSecondary - Whether to start the instance as secondary
|
||||
* if there is already a primary instance.
|
||||
* @arg {Mode} mode - Whether for the SingleApplication block to be applied
|
||||
* User wide or System wide.
|
||||
* @arg {int} timeout - Timeout to wait in miliseconds.
|
||||
* @note argc and argv may be changed as Qt removes arguments that it
|
||||
* recognizes
|
||||
* @note Mode::SecondaryNotification only works if set on both the primary
|
||||
* instance and the secondary instance.
|
||||
* @note The timeout is just a hint for the maximum time of blocking
|
||||
* operations. It does not guarantee that the SingleApplication
|
||||
* initialisation will be completed in given time, though is a good hint.
|
||||
* Usually 4*timeout would be the worst case (fail) scenario.
|
||||
* @see See the corresponding QAPPLICATION_CLASS constructor for reference
|
||||
*/
|
||||
explicit SingleApplication (int &argc, char *argv[], bool allowSecondary = false, Options options = Mode::User, int timeout = 100);
|
||||
~SingleApplication ();
|
||||
|
||||
/**
|
||||
* @brief Returns if the instance is the primary instance
|
||||
* @returns {bool}
|
||||
*/
|
||||
bool isPrimary ();
|
||||
|
||||
/**
|
||||
* @brief Returns if the instance is a secondary instance
|
||||
* @returns {bool}
|
||||
*/
|
||||
bool isSecondary ();
|
||||
|
||||
/**
|
||||
* @brief Returns a unique identifier for the current instance
|
||||
* @returns {int}
|
||||
*/
|
||||
quint32 instanceId ();
|
||||
|
||||
/**
|
||||
* @brief Sends a message to the primary instance. Returns true on success.
|
||||
* @param {int} timeout - Timeout for connecting
|
||||
* @returns {bool}
|
||||
* @note sendMessage() will return false if invoked from the primary
|
||||
* instance.
|
||||
*/
|
||||
bool sendMessage (QByteArray message, int timeout = 100);
|
||||
|
||||
Q_SIGNALS:
|
||||
void instanceStarted ();
|
||||
void receivedMessage (quint32 instanceId, QByteArray message);
|
||||
|
||||
private:
|
||||
SingleApplicationPrivate *d_ptr;
|
||||
Q_DECLARE_PRIVATE(SingleApplication)
|
||||
};
|
||||
|
||||
Q_DECLARE_OPERATORS_FOR_FLAGS(SingleApplication::Options)
|
||||
|
||||
#endif // SINGLE_APPLICATION_H
